General Information

Title: See, See the Shepherds' Queen
Composer: Thomas Tomkins

Number of voices: 5vv  Voicing: SSATB
Genre: Secular, Madrigals
Language: English
Instruments: none, a cappella

Original text and translations

Template:English See, see the shepherds' Queen,
fair Phyllis all in green,
Fa la la...
the shepherds home her bringing
with piping and with singing,
Fa la la...
Then dance we on a row,
and chant it as we go.
Fa la la...
